Heat Recovery - Air Compressors

Arbe offer systems to recover heat from air compressors, ready for use in space heating or domestic hot water.  In oil-cooled compressors, we can offer packages that recover up to 94% of the energy used to produce compressed air. This can be in the form of hot water up to 70 DegC which is stored in an Arbe AF thermal store. From here, it can then be utilised in a space heating system, with it pumped throughout a building to fan coil units to replace gas or oil fired space heaters, or it can be transferred into a potable hot water system, either as a preheat on larger systems or as the main heat source.

Around 95% of energy used in compressors is converted to heat and is wasted to atmosphere through heat dissipation and through the cooling process, with the majority of it lost through the oil cooler. By redirecting the hot oil through a high-efficiency oil to water heat exchanger, we can recover this heat, reducing costs on the heating bills on most applications.

A typical heat recovery system for a compressor can have a quick pay back on capital investment, starting at around 1-1.5 years on a DHW system and a maximum of 3 years on a full heating system. This includes installation of new fan coil units and necessary controls to ensure correct operation.

Air Compressor Heat Recovery

DHW Preheat Systems

Arbe HevaPak HRU heat recovery systems offer a solution for recovering heat from the compressors and utilising the heat for preheating cold water being fed into domestic hot water generators. This can have a big impact on fuel bills, not only in the reduced use of fossil fuels but also reduced carbon charges and taxes. There are also savings to be made by the reduction in use of the cooling fans on compressors, bringing operating costs down for compressed air production.

A typical preheat system would consist of the following:

  • Connections to the compressor(s)

  • Thermal store

  • Feed pumps

  • Indirect cylinder

  • Control valves

  • Pasteurisation system

  • PLC Controls package

Air Compressor Heat Recovery

Space Heating Systems

Arbe HevaPak HRU heat recovery systems can be installed to recover heat and distribute throughout a factory or other building for space heating. Our systems can be supplied into traditional radiator systems or new systems using fan coil units or underfloor heating.
